Key Operational Features
8 Universal Analog Input Channels — independently configurable per channel for thermocouple (J/K/T/E/R/S/B), RTD (Pt100/Pt1000), 4-20mA, 1-5V, and 0-10V inputs, supporting Process Optimization across diverse sensor ecosystems.
16-Bit A/D Resolution — delivers ±0.1% of span measurement accuracy, meeting the precision demands of mission-critical process variables in refining, power, and life sciences applications.
Integrated HART Transparency — simultaneous analog measurement and HART digital communication on current-loop channels, enabling smart transmitter diagnostics and secondary variable access without additional field wiring.
High Availability via Redundancy Support — dual-module parallel operation with automatic failover ensures continuous signal acquisition during module swap or failure, a critical feature for Seamless Integration into redundant Ovation architectures.
Continuous Self-Diagnostics — real-time detection of open circuits, sensor burnout, out-of-range conditions, and wiring faults, with alarm propagation to the Ovation operator station before process upsets escalate.
Cold Junction Compensation (CJC) — onboard CJC circuitry eliminates external reference junctions for thermocouple inputs, simplifying field wiring and improving long-term measurement stability.

Comprehensive Data Sheet
| Attribute | Technical Data |
|---|---|
| Part Number | 1C31224G01 |
| Manufacturer | Emerson (Ovation Platform) |
| Module Type | 8-Channel Universal Analog Input |
| Input Signal Types | Thermocouple (J, K, T, E, R, S, B), RTD (Pt100, Pt1000), 4-20mA, 1-5V, 0-10V |
| A/D Resolution | 16-bit |
| Measurement Accuracy | ±0.1% of span (typical) |
| Channel Isolation | Channel-to-channel & channel-to-bus galvanic isolation |
| HART Support | Integrated on 4-20mA current loop inputs |
| Update Rate | Configurable: 100ms — 10s per channel |
| Operating Temperature | 40°C to +70°C |
| Power Consumption | 5W maximum (backplane supply) |
| Noise Rejection | 50Hz / 60Hz configurable notch filters |
| Redundancy | Dual-module parallel with automatic failover |
| Compatible Base Assembly | 1C31227G01 |
| Configuration Tool | Ovation Developer Studio |
| MTBF | >150,000 hours |
| Compliance | ISO 9001, IEC 61511, FDA 21 CFR Part 11 (calibration traceability) |
| Product Status | New & Original — Factory Sealed |

Engineering Support & FAQ
Q1: What base assembly is required to mount the 1C31224G01 in an Ovation I/O rack?
The 1C31224G01 requires the 1C31227G01 Analog Input Base Assembly for physical mounting and backplane connectivity. Ensure the base assembly is correctly seated and the terminal block module (5A26137G03) is installed before inserting the I/O module.
Q2: Which Ovation controller firmware versions are compatible with this module?
The 1C31224G01 is compatible with Ovation controller firmware versions 3.x and later. For systems running firmware below 3.0, a controller upgrade is recommended prior to module installation. Always verify compatibility using the Ovation Hardware Compatibility Matrix available from Emerson Process Management.
Q3: Can individual channels be configured for different input types simultaneously?
Yes. Each of the 8 channels on the 1C31224G01 is independently configurable through Ovation Developer Studio. Channels can be assigned different sensor types (e.g., Channel 1 as K-type thermocouple, Channel 2 as 4-20mA) within the same module, eliminating the need for multiple specialized I/O cards.
Q4: How is in-situ calibration verification performed without removing the module?
Calibration verification is performed via Ovation Developer Studio by injecting precision reference signals through the terminal block while the module remains in the rack. This procedure validates measurement accuracy against NIST-traceable standards without interrupting adjacent channel operation or requiring module extraction.
